Search Results for "coffee-farmers" (979 articles)
Monday, July 28, 2025
Saturday, July 12, 2025
Wednesday, June 18, 2025
Sunday, June 15, 2025
Thursday, June 12, 2025
Thursday, May 15, 2025
Wednesday, April 02, 2025
Monday, March 31, 2025
Monday, March 31, 2025
